The Miles Consultancy (TMC) has announced a rebrand, reflecting its commitment to growth and expansion into new territories with new technology and new products.

There is a revamped mileage capture mobile application, the deployment of Mobility iQ and the introduction of Fleet+ in a new, digital and centralised fleet management system.

TMC currently serves more than 400 clients in 73 countries with a range of digital solutions helping businesses manage their fleets. 

The vision for the future, it says, is not only to continue to provide these services, but to deploy new products globally and allow businesses to benefit from technology that streamlines their operations, reduces costs, monitors carbon and ensures compliance.

Paul Jackson, CEO and founder of The Miles Consultancy, explained: “Our digital transformation empowers clients with a comprehensive ecosystem of products and global operational capabilities, enabling data-driven control and optimisation of their cost, carbon and compliance for every mile driven.”

The rebrand sees the introduction of a new logo and house style, representing the business’ refreshed identity and approach for the future. 

TMC was founded in 2002 to provide vehicle fleet operators with a better alternative to the paper or spreadsheet-based processes that business drivers traditionally used for mileage claims and reporting.
